Abstract

This draft report is written for the XIX International Congress of Comparative Law that will take place in July 2014 in Vienna. The report gives an overview of the current status of mediation in civil and commercial matters in Belgium. The framework is the Belgian Act of February 21, 2005 on Mediation, that dates from before the 2008 European Mediation Directive. The report describes in detail the voluntary (or out-of-court) and judicial (or court-connected) mediation procedures, the mediation agreement and the voluntariness of mediation, the accreditation process of Belgian mediators, the confidentiality of mediation, and the costs of mediation. Finally, some brief conclusions are made regarding the modest success of (judicial) mediation in Belgium.
